I rise today in support of h. R. 5527. The Technology Modernization fund or the t. M. F. Was established by the bipartisan republicanled modernizing Government Technology act of 2017. The t. M. F. Was established because it could be difficult to plan and budget for federal legacy i. T. Upgrades law that the annual appropriations cycle. The t. M. F. Addresses this problem by acting as a selfsustaining funding mechanism to assist agency with legacy i. T. Modernization projects that span multiple fiscal years. The federal government depends on i. T. Systems for everything from National Defense to the administration to benefits programs. Over the course of this congress, the House Oversight subcommittee on cybersecurity, Information Technology and government innovation has heard from current and former government officials about the risks and costs associated with the federal legacy i. T. Systems. These risks include cyberattacks targeted toward highly vulnerable legacy systems that house sensitive public data. These half century old i. T. Systems are prime targets for malicious actors and enemy nation states. My bill, the modernizing Government Technology reform act, enhances the Technology Modernization fund by ensuring that as a sustainable financing tool for fixing costly and risky legacy i. T. Systems. The t. M. F. Has straight from the orange congressional intent established by the bipartisan law congress passed. It does not consistently require agencies to repay their awards and operational policy decision made by the administration which has put a strain on t. M. F. s resources and hindered the funds ability to help address future legacy i. T. Modernization projects. With this legislation well refows can refocus the t. M. F. On replacing i. T. Systems and address our cybersecurity risks. The reforms made to the t. M. F. By h. R. 5527 also prioritize fiscal responsibility and theyre common sense. Lets run through some of them quickly in the bill. This will require restorations. It requires the t. M. F. To recover all administrative costs that projects incur. Requires the t. M. F. To suspend or terminate project funding in fraudulent or miss leading statements misleading statements were used to obtain funds. It provides agencies more flexibility to repay the t. M. F. It increases the visibility into t. M. F. Awards by requiring written agreements governing each award to be made publicly available. This legislation also requires each agency conduct an inventory of its legacy i. T. Systems, creating a new oversight tool to ensure the federal government is addressing the problem of legacy i. T. Systems. Reforming the t. M. F. Is necessary to ensure it remains a sustainable, Revolving Fund that can be used to address the costly challenge of modernizing legacy i. T. Into the future. In this century Public Confidence in the federal government depends on ensuring that our federal Information Technology systems and websites are secure, safe and effective. We invest more than 100 billion every year in federal i. T. Needs. Outdated legacy i. T. Systems and infrastructure are costly to maintain and very challenging to secure against the onslaught of Cyber Attacks by adversaries and criminal organizations. The constantly changing landscape of Information Technology requires resources if federal agencies are going to be able to protect data privacy, complete their missions and effectively serve our people. The modernizing Government Technology reform act would ensure this important work continues smoothly by extending the Technology Modernization fund sunset from december, 2025, to december, 2031. It would also clarify the use of funds and maintain the repayment flexibility adopted by the Technology Modernization fund known as the t. M. F. In recent years while ensuring its solvency by setting minimum reimbursement requirements. Additionally, the bill sets requirements for regularly updating inventories and lists of i. T. Systems and highrisk federal i. T. Systems as well as the legacy systems that present the greatest security, privacy and operational risks. This timely and comprehensive picture of the federal governments most serious i. T. Modernization needs will inform the t. M. F. Inform the ability of the t. M. F. To make the best investments. The t. M. F. Provides a selfsustaining funding model thats become an essential tool for federal agencies to address these challenges. It supplies upfront funding for i. T. Projects in exchange for future reimbursement once a projects cost saves are realized, allowing agencies the flexibility they need to address modernization needs outside of the traditional budget cycle. T. M. F. Also instills accountability safeguards to ensure that taxpayers are getting strong returns on our investments. Projects are selected for funding after rigorous review by the t. M. F. Board of Technology Experts and written funding agreements outlined specific requirements and milestones that have to be met. Funds are distributed incrementally based on performance as assessed by quarterly review business the board and technical experts provide handson support towards successful execution of the projects. Committee democrats have supported robust oversight and funding for the t. M. F. Including an historic billiondollar investment through the American Rescue plan. With this infusion, high priority projects were also allowed reduced repayment requirements if warranted since the infusion of these moneys, the t. M. F. Has received more than 220 agency proposals requesting more than 3. 5 billion, far outpacing our funding availability. To date the t. M. F. Has provided over 900 million to 57i. T. Modernization projects across 32 agencies and the Bidenharris Administration has embraced it as an indispensable tool to better serve the American People. For example, t. M. F. Funding is helping to digitize veterans records, ensuring that more than one Million People and their family members who reach out to the National Archives and Records Administration every year get timely access to the documents they need to verify their qualification for important lifesaving benefits. T. M. F. Fund something also expediting the speed and safety of food inspection at the usda, leading to better meals for school kids and Service Members alike. T. M. F. Funding also better secures all of our personal data at the Social Security administration and at the department of education. Its no secret that americas Cyber Infrastructure is under constant attack by our adversaries, including china, russia, iran and north korea. F. B. I. Director Christopher Wray recently warned americans that the cyber threat that china poses, declairing that china declaring that chinas hackers are preparing to wreak havoc and cause realworld harm to american citizens and communities. Yet despite warning after warning of the rising threats to our nations Cyber Infrastructure, our federal agencies remain dangerously vulnerable to future potentially devastating Cyber Attacks. Every year the federal government spends over 100 billion on i. T. And Cyber Security but 80 of this spending goes to operating and maintaining outdated, obsolete legacy systems. These aging systems not only waste taxpayer money, but leave us exposed to our enemies. These i. T. Systems also require specific Technical Knowledge to operate and update, which creates enormous procurement and hiring challenges. Leaving agencies scrambling to find vendors and employees with the necessary skills. In addition to the upfront costs associated with the updating legacy i. T. , many of these systems continue to run with no known security vulnerabilities and this is a ticking time bomb. In order to bring the federal government up to speed, congress established the Technology Modernization fund to help eliminate these vulnerabilities and replace antiquated i. T. Systems and strengthening our cyber defense. Reauthorizing and reforming the Technology Modernization fund is essential to our future success. Under this legislation, federal agencies can continue the modernization process and adopt Safer Technology and adopt technology with congressional oversight to keep efforts on track. As my colleagues mentioned, this bill establishes a legacy i. T. Inventory to enable congress to evaluate agency and governmentwide efforts to modernize i. T. Tech and ensure that such critical modernization efforts are being done the right way. Our National Security is at stake. We cant afford to become complacent with our adversaries. R. 5887, outdated bureaucratic government processes make it challenging to deliver Government Services. This creates opportunities for fraud and abuse. These processes do not change because federal agencies lack a designated official that congress can hold accountable for program Service Delivery and backlogs and process applications or improperly delivered benefits. Many Agency Officials, Program Managers, policy makers, Resource Managers are responsible for specific parts of the problem. The developing solutions to poor Government Service delivery will require someone to be available for governmentwide coordination. This addresses this problem by requiring the office of management and budget and designate a senior official for improving Government Service and facilitating process reforms. It will develop standards and performance metrics. Also under the bill, Senior Agency officials designated to be responsible for Service Delivery will be required to coordinate with other Agency Officials such as the chief Information Officer and Program Managers as they work to improve operation. And the expansion of the bipartisan 21st century integrated experience act of 2018 will improve congressional oversight over the Government Service delivery reform efforts.
